Output 37631cea5fc697f589c4dab3f944cdeeb712ec0498b23a4c8a1c196e9fbb918f:2

value
60929990
script pubkey
OP_0 OP_PUSHBYTES_20 4f5e67294eae7c622b1cc190d9dcb0156540a788
address
ltc1qfa0xw22w4e7xy2cucxgdnh9sz4j5pfugjt5yua
transaction
37631cea5fc697f589c4dab3f944cdeeb712ec0498b23a4c8a1c196e9fbb918f
spent
true